IBattis 默认超时时间好像是30s,可多于这个时间总就会报错:DaoProxy : unable to intercept method name 'ExcuteQuery', cause : 超时时间已到.在操作完成之前超时时间已过或服务器未响应. 于是就百度了,找了好多也就是配置一个TimeOut就可以于是看到我们之前有配置是ConnectTimeout ="60" 想了想60s太短来个600s 可一到30就Out了 于是看了一下SqlMapSession的原码中有一句dbC…
ProjectReview.Test.SqlMapTest.TestSqlMap:IBatisNet.Common.Exceptions.ConfigurationException : - The error occurred while configure DaoSessionHandler.- The error occurred in <property name="resource" value="App_Data\sqlMap.config" xm…
LINUX 5 常用ftp telnet配置 一.解决远程登陆乱码问题 目标:在xwindow和其console中使用中文界面,在纯console中使用英文 在/etc/profile最后加上一行 export LC_ALL=en_US 在/etc/sysconfig/i18n最后加上一行 export LC_ALL="zh_CN.GB18030" 重新启动就能生效 二.telnet与FTP服务配置 telnet 服务配置 1.确定服务列表中已经开启所需要的telnet服务.(下面显示…
在struts2-core-2.1.8.1.jar的org.apache.struts2包下面的default.properties资源文件里可以查到常用的常量配置,这些不用刻意的记住:忘记的时候可以查询.总结长用的的常量配置如下面: <!-- 设置url请求后缀 --> <constant name="struts.action.extension" value="do,action,html,htm"></constant>…
Git是一个开源的分布式版本控制系统,用于敏捷高效地处理任何或小或大的项目. Git 是 Linus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的版本控制软件. Git 与常用的版本控制工具 CVS, Subversion 等不同,它采用了分布式版本库的方式,不必服务器端软件支持. Git安装配置 本文主要讲解linux上如何安装配置Git Centos/RedHat $ yum install curl-devel expat-devel gettext-deve…
[理论] 在很多情况下,你需要设置程序的某些行为,这时你就需要使用配置变量.在Flask中,配置变量就是一些大写形式的Python变量, 你也可以称之为配置参数或配置键.使用统一的配置变量可以避免在程序中以硬编码的形式设置程序. 在一个项目中,你会用到许多配置,Flask提供的配置,扩展(比如flask-sqlalchemy,flask-mail)提供的配置,还有程序特定的配置. 和平时使用的变量不同,这些配置变量都通过Flask对象的app.config属性作为统一的接口来设置和获取,它指向的…
  回忆一下,在前面的文章中,我们使用了spring cloud eureka/ribbon/feign/hystrix/zuul搭建了一个完整的微服务系统,不管是队内还是对外都已经比较完善了,那我们的系统是否还有值得继续优化的地方呢?答案肯定是有的,那就是分布式配置中心config.那什么是分布式配置中心,我们为什么又需要分布式配置中心呢? 什么是分布式配置中心?   所谓配置中心,就是将配置的数据放在某种存储介质中,该介质可以是文件/数据库/中间件等等,像业界常用的zookeeper/Apo…
配置web.config有两处地方需要配置,分别是集成模式和经典模式. 集成模式: <!--文件上传大小设置--> <httpRuntime requestValidationMode="2.0" executionTimeout="90" maxRequestLength="2147483" useFullyQualifiedRedirectUrl="false" minFreeThreads="…
IntelliJ常用快捷键及配置 目录: 1.常用快捷键: 2.常用配置: 1.常用快捷键: (1)psvm:创建main函数 (2)fori:for (int i = 0; i < ; i++) {} (3)sout:System.out.println() (4)ctrl + n:查找类 (5)ctrl + shift + n:查找文件 (6)ctrl + alt + l:格式化代码 (7)ctrl + alt + o:格式化import列表,删除掉已导入但未使用的包 (8)ctrl + x…
方案一:传统作法(不推荐) 服务端负载均衡 将所有的Config Server都指向同一个Git仓库,这样所有的配置内容就通过统一的共享文件系统来维护,而客户端在指定Config Server位置时,只要配置Config Server外的均衡负载即可. 注:服务器端负载均衡和客户端负载均衡的区别 存在的问题: 客户端都是直接调用配置中心的server端来获取配置文件信息.这样就存在了一个问题,客户端和服务端的耦合性太高,如果server端要做集群,客户端只能通过原始的方式来路由,server端改…